By The Numbers: Iowa State
2 – Iowa State has given up 400 yards through the air twice since 2009 (Kansas). Both times were to OSU.
415 – The 9th best passing day in OSU history by a single player.
3 – J.W. Walsh now has three 300+ yard passing games. Only Weeden, Fields, and Robinson have more.
.14 – OSU gave up only .14 points per play, their 5th best mark in the last three seasons[1. Only Savannah, Tech (’11), OU (’11), and Arizona (bowl) were better.].
12 – Iowa State had gone 12 straight games holding its opponent to under 30 points in regulation. That was snapped today.
11 – Iowa State didn’t score on its last 11 possessions.
13 – Josh Stewart had 13 catches which is the second most in a single game in OSU history (it’s been done nine (!) times). Alex Lloyd (?) had 16 against Kansas in 1949.
424 – Kirby Van Der Kamp (ISU’s punter) had 424 yards punting, the most anybody had doing anything on Saturday.
129 – A new white guy WR record for yards in a single game in the Gundy era. Congrats, Chuck Moore.
22 – OSU has put up 500 yards in 22 of its last 32 games.
161 – J.W. Walsh needs 161 yards to set the all-time single season freshman passing record.
63 – Mike Gundy now has more wins than any coach in OSU history.
34 – OSU is now 34-0 in the Gundy era when holding its opponent to fewer than 20 points.
